10 Week Art Therapy Group for Therapists
You spend your days holding space for others. This group is an invitation to have space held for you. This 10-week closed creative support group is designed for psychotherapists from any background who are seeking a place to slow down, recenter, and connect with peers through the creative and reflective process.
This is not a traditional supervision group and not focused on case consultation. Instead, we’ll gather as colleagues, using creative arts practices—including visual art, journaling, reflection, and group process – to support our own wellbeing, insight, and connection. No art experience is needed. Psychotherapists from all backgrounds and approaches are welcome.
